Karl, 

Interesting.  I purchased two Globe Model 418's from Defender a couple of
months ago and basically got the run around from Mr. Koenig telling me I was
mistaken.  After several e-mails I gave up, used a Yanmar replacement, and
was planning to discuss with the local Globe distributor.  Maybe he finally
realized there really was a problem on their end.  .  

Thanks for the heads-up.

Attention:

The last 2 times I replaced the water pump impeller in my Yanmar 3GM30F
(Japan version), I've used the Globe (Model 418). Globe impellers are
reportedly made of elastomer compounds, developed for optimum performance
and self-lubricating for run-dry protection. Additionally, Globe impellers
are said to have greater resistance to sand and dirt abrasion.

My water pump shaft requires a 3/16" keyway and the Globe 418 impeller seem
to fit OK in the past. The last one I purchased (from Defender) only had a
1/8" keyway, however, and did not fit.

I contacted Globe via their website and received a reply from Matthew W.
Koenig, Business Manager, Marine Products Division. After some
investigation, he confirmed that the 418 should have had a 3/16" keyway, not
the 1/8" that I had. He has sent me 2 replacements at no charge.

The bottomline is that if you have one of these in your 'spares' box, you'd
better check the dimensions, before you need to install it.
